Output 76bf0b8a3fa9b7aaaaf7adf8dabbe203078e9d3e7f3692028ff66b45b11020e5:13

value
13507239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75a3ae261e8ce63fba38f228a719a0ca3c0e857 OP_EQUAL
address
3QEtvDZQ9JZcLJRzbeFKEZYRvvv2bfP1tZ
transaction
76bf0b8a3fa9b7aaaaf7adf8dabbe203078e9d3e7f3692028ff66b45b11020e5
confirmations
166352
spent
true